Local NASA astronaut is back on Earth after piloting mission to International Space Station

CO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. (KRDO) – After nearly five months orbiting Earth on the International Space Station (ISS), Woodland Park’s own Nichole Ayers is back home – or at least back on solid ground.

Ayers, a graduate of Woodland Park High School and the U.S. Air Force Academy, splashed down in the Pacific Ocean off the coast of California on the morning of Saturday, Aug. 9 – marking the successful completion of NASA’s 10th commercial crew rotation mission to the ISS.

Ayers is a member of the SpaceX Crew-10, joined by fellow NASA astronaut Anne McClain, a Russian cosmonaut and a member of Japan’s space program. The team of four launched from Kennedy Space Center on March 14, landing on the ISS about 29 hours later…
